From eb11e5963b8e155fd418f750013bdf1ffadbcb83 Mon Sep 17 00:00:00 2001 From: lea Date: Sat, 18 Jan 2025 14:13:46 -0800 Subject: [PATCH] Revert "fix(server): generate tetsudou.json when deleteRPM" --- server/repos.go | 4 ---- server/rpm/repo.go | 6 +++--- 2 files changed, 3 insertions(+), 7 deletions(-) diff --git a/server/repos.go b/server/repos.go index 9eb7d92..40b3b0d 100644 --- a/server/repos.go +++ b/server/repos.go @@ -554,10 +554,6 @@ func (router *reposRouter) deleteRPM(w http.ResponseWriter, r *http.Request) { panic(err) } } - - if err := rpm.WriteTetsudouMetadata(targetDirectory); err != nil { - panic(err) - } w.WriteHeader(http.StatusNoContent) diff --git a/server/rpm/repo.go b/server/rpm/repo.go index 3b11573..a95ede1 100644 --- a/server/rpm/repo.go +++ b/server/rpm/repo.go @@ -23,7 +23,7 @@ func CreateRepo(repoPath string) error { return err } - if err := WriteTetsudouMetadata(repoPath); err != nil { + if err := writeTetsudouMetadata(repoPath); err != nil { return err } @@ -57,14 +57,14 @@ func UpdateRepo(repoPath string) error { return err } - if err := WriteTetsudouMetadata(repoPath); err != nil { + if err := writeTetsudouMetadata(repoPath); err != nil { return err } return nil } -func WriteTetsudouMetadata(repoPath string) error { +func writeTetsudouMetadata(repoPath string) error { // We calculate and write some metadata for Tetsudou, which is our mirroring system // This is not strictly necessary for the repo to function, but it's useful for our use case (and possibly others) repomd, err := os.Open(path.Join(repoPath, "repodata/repomd.xml"))